Area contextNeighborhood Overview – Moores Park School (Lansing, MI)
Moores Park School is situated in Lansing, Michigan's capital city, offering a blend of urban convenience and suburban tranquility. Located southwest of downtown, the school benefits from its proximity to the Grand River and the scenic parklands that surround it. Access is primarily gained via Moores River Drive, which connects to major thoroughfares like South Washington Avenue and Aurelius Road, facilitating travel from across the region. For those flying in, Lansing Capital Region International Airport (LAN) is approximately a 15-20 minute drive northeast, depending on traffic. Public transportation options exist via the Capital Area Transportation Authority (CATA) bus lines, with routes serving nearby streets. Driving is the most common method for accessing the school, and visitors should anticipate moderate traffic, especially during peak hours or school drop-off/pick-up times. Planning to arrive 15-20 minutes before scheduled events is advisable to account for parking and navigation around the immediate vicinity.

Impression 5 Science Center
The Impression 5 Science Center is an engaging, hands-on museum designed to spark curiosity in visitors of all ages. Located a short drive from Moores Park School, it offers interactive exhibits focused on science, technology, engineering, art, and math (STEAM). This is an ideal destination for families or teams seeking an educational and entertaining diversion, especially during inclement weather. Children and adults alike can explore concepts through playful experimentation, making it a great place to learn and have fun.
500 Museum Dr · 1.6 miMichigan State Capitol Building
The historic Michigan State Capitol Building, a stunning example of 19th-century architecture, is a significant landmark in downtown Lansing. Visitors can take guided tours to learn about the state's government, history, and the building's intricate design. Its grandeur and central location make it a worthwhile stop for those interested in history and architecture. The surrounding Capitol grounds are also pleasant for a stroll, offering views of the legislative complex and downtown skyline.

Weather & Seasons at Moores Park School
- Winter: Winter in Lansing is characterized by cold temperatures, often dipping below freezing, and frequent snowfall. Visitors should pack heavy coats, gloves, hats, and waterproof boots. Outdoor activities at Moores Park School or the adjacent park become limited, and travel may be affected by road conditions. Indoor venues and indoor dining become primary options for families and teams.
- Spring & early summer: Spring brings gradually warming temperatures, with a mix of sunny days and frequent rain showers. Lightweight jackets and layered clothing are recommended. Outdoor activities become more feasible, but having a rain plan is essential. Temperatures range from cool to comfortably warm, ideal for athletic events with occasional need for umbrellas or rain gear.
- Mid-summer: Mid-summer in Lansing is typically warm to hot and humid, with temperatures often reaching into the 80s and 90s Fahrenheit. Lightweight, breathable clothing is a must. Sunscreen, hats, and plenty of water are crucial for any outdoor events or park visits. Evenings can offer a pleasant cool-down, but daytime activities require preparation for heat.
- Fall season: Fall offers crisp air and beautiful foliage, with temperatures generally cool and pleasant, transitioning to cold as the season progresses. Layers are key, including sweaters, light jackets, and comfortable walking shoes. This season is excellent for outdoor sports and park exploration, though early morning and late evening events may require warmer outerwear.
- Rain & snow: Rain is possible year-round but most frequent in spring and fall. Snowfall is typical from late November through March. Visitors should always check the forecast closer to their travel dates. In case of heavy rain or snow, indoor alternatives such as the Impression 5 Science Center or the State Capitol Building are good options for keeping busy and dry.
